Transaction 172e7c34b74cdfc3236f02765430c8f8286fd25e85a2dd1a7f6b7ff08ad32528

1 Input
2 Outputs
  • 172e7c34b74cdfc3236f02765430c8f8286fd25e85a2dd1a7f6b7ff08ad32528:0
  • value  119231
    address  32caq3uWASkaoJVWmarsL5rvgLL8yExKWd
  • 172e7c34b74cdfc3236f02765430c8f8286fd25e85a2dd1a7f6b7ff08ad32528:1
  • value  663713
    address  38tJ76AfcU4ndPiRBv7cwa4AXcPjn8aCmT